The Central African Republic, despite its cultural and natural wealth, is confronted with deep inequalities which hinder its development and compromise social stability. These disparities affect different areas of daily life, ranging from access to basic services to the distribution of wealth. This article examines the main sources of inequality in the Central African Republic, analyzes their consequences and explores ways to mitigate this complex problem.
